Description

A stateful AI agent workflow powered by Supabase and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G). Enables persistent memory, dynamic CRUD operations, and multi-tenant data isolation for AI-driven applications like customer support, task orchestration, and knowledge management.

Key Features :

  • 🧠 RAG Integration : Leverages OpenAI embeddings and Supabase vector search for context-aware responses.
  • 🗃️ Full CRUD : Manage agent_messages, agent_tasks, agent_status, and agent_knowledge in real time.
  • 📤 Multi-Tenant Ready : Supports per-user/organization data isolation via dynamic table names and webhooks.
  • 🔒 Secure : Role-based access control via Supabase Row Level Security (RLS).

Use Cases

  1. Customer Support Chatbots : Persist conversation history and resolve queries using institutional knowledge.
  2. Automated Task Management : Track and update task statuses dynamically.
  3. Knowledge Repositories : Store and retrieve domain-specific information for AI agents.

Instructions

1. Import Template

  • Go to n8n > Templates > Import from File and upload this workflow.

2. Configure Credentials

  • Add your Supabase and OpenAI API keys under Settings > Credentials.

3. Set Up Multi-Tenancy (Optional)

  • Dynamic Webhook Path :
    Replace the default webhook path with /mcp/tool/supabase/:userId to enable per-user routing.
  • Table Names :
    Use a Set Node to dynamically generate table names (e.g., agent_messages_{{userId}}).

4. Activate & Test

  • Enable the workflow and send test requests to the webhook URL.
